As mentioned in the "about our project" section this web site results from two different European projects both funded by the Socrates / Minerva program of the European Commission.
In the first phase of our project, the VISIONARY project (2000-2003), a team of experts from five countries – Germany, Denmark, Finland, Portugal and the UK - created the basic structure of this portal. Apart from this we published the book "Violence Prevention in School Using the Internet" that gives an overview of violence and violence prevention in our five countries with a focus on resources that are available on the Internet.
In the second phase, the VISIONARIES-NET project (2004-2006), we completely revised our portal and extended it by three further languages: French, Spanish and Romanian. Furthermore the four partners of this second phase - Germany, France, Spain and Romania - hold five online conferences that aim to bring together different groups of experts on school bullying and violence from different countries and cultures.
